Cox-Orange: Apfeltraum aus dem Hausgarten

Frisch aus dem Hausgarten geerntet, punkten die Äpfel der Sorte Cox-Orange mit einer herben Süße, die einfach unwiderstehlich ist. Kein Wunder, dass Cox-Orange schon seit dem 19. Jahrhundert zu den beliebtesten Winterapfelsorten Europas zählt. Reifen die kleinen, festen Früchte hingegen in der warmen Bodenseesonne, dann zeichnen sie sich durch eine besonders ausgewogene Mischung an feiner Süße und erfrischender Säure aus. Auch im sortenreinen Edelbrand vom prämierten Brenner Otto Koch ist diese charakteristische fein säuerlich-fruchtige Note eine Überraschung am Gaumen. Dabei kommt dieser edle Apfelbrand ganz ohne künstliche Zusätze und Zucker aus.
